Summary

Protein Losing Enteropathy (PLE) is a serious medical condition that may develop in children and adults with congenital heart disease for which a palliative procedure known as the "Fontan procedure" has been performed. The loss of serum proteins into the gastrointestinal tract that is associated with PLE can cause serious symptoms and life-threatening complications. A number of clinical studies have suggested that heparin administration can have clinical benefit in children with PLE, however the risk of bleeding associated with the administration of heparin is an important concern and commonly limits its administration. ODSH is a desulfated heparin with minimal anticoagulation properties but which, in pre-clinical studies, appears to have the potential to replace heparin and greatly reduce the risk of bleeding. This open label study is to assess the safety and evidence of therapeutic effect of the administration of ODSH as a 4-day continuous intravenous infusion in patients with an exacerbation of their PLE.

Interventions

DRUG

ODSH at 0.125 mg/kg/h

ODSH 1000 mg vials containing 20 cc of normal saline (50 mg/ml) to be prepared for 96-h IV infusion with normal saline based on subject's weight and dose assigned by Study Cohort 1 of 0.125 mg/kg/h.

DRUG

ODSH at 0.375 mg/kg/h

ODSH 1000 mg vials containing 20 cc of normal saline (50 mg/ml) to be prepared for 96-h IV infusion with normal saline based on subject's weight and dose assigned by Study Cohort 3 of 0.375 mg/kg/h.

DRUG

ODSH at 0.250 mg/kg/h

ODSH 1000 mg vials containing 20 cc of normal saline (50 mg/ml) to be prepared for 96-h IV infusion with normal saline based on subject's weight and dose assigned by Study Cohort 2 of 0.250 mg/kg/h.
